The game focuses on leading a samurai invasion across Awaji, recruiting and promoting warriors, establishing mobile camps, capturing strategic locations, and responding to dynamic enemy forces. Players considering the full release should pay particular attention to the systems that define the experience rather than relying only on a short trailer.
Immersive Strategy
Lead armies from a first-person perspective while making strategic decisions across the island.
Open-World Campaign
Travel between villages, forts, shrines, roads, and roaming enemy forces in a reactive environment.
Warrior Management
Recruit samurai, assign formations, promote leaders, and improve equipment over time.
Mobile Camp
Build a movable war camp with defensive structures, supplies, rest areas, and guards.

System Requirements Before Downloading
Checking hardware before installation is especially important for a large open-world strategy game with real-time battles and detailed environments. The published requirements should be treated as the baseline for deciding whether your computer is ready.
| Component | Minimum Requirement | Recommended Requirement |
|---|---|---|
| Operating system | Windows 10 64-bit | Windows 11 64-bit |
| Processor | Intel i5 9th Gen | Intel i7 11th Gen |
| Memory | 16 GB RAM | 32 GB RAM |
| Graphics | NVIDIA GeForce GTX 2060 | NVIDIA GeForce RTX 3070 |
| Storage | 6 GB available space | 6 GB available space |
The minimum specification is intended to establish basic compatibility, while the recommended specification provides more headroom for battles, open-world travel, and higher visual settings. Meeting the minimum does not guarantee that every scene will perform identically.
